Michelle Gross, Thank you!!!!! for speaking out about the decision to send in the good ol boyz. I thought this was once tried before, and when it was the people who suffered were primary those of color and those that are decent folk, who lived in these communities.

I does not make sense to continue to send in troops, when that is not solving the problem. Another thing, Some people here in Hawthorne have documented criminal activities, morning, noon and night. We have called and spoke to people, i.e. CCP_SAFE, inspections and the like, and to this point nothing, I repeat nothing has been done yet. Even though there is video taped evidence.

Bringing in the Troops will only move the problem, as it has many times before. What I'd like to know is where's the game plan, where the solution to problems many people are faced with having to survive? What about actions, not band aids......Why do we have continue to do thing's that give a false comfort? Jordan is not the only one with problems, neither is this city for that matter.

Has anyone even began to sit down and come up with creative solutions to the problems at hand, or is the answer to every problem, send out the troopers. Who ultimately suffers? the criminal's? Heck no!, It the decent african american's and others that live there. We haven;t even solved the problems of DWB, driving while black, and yet we send in more officers, who don't know the neighborhood, or the people for that matter, to have more problems......

Being a politician is never easy, but when you get the job, these are the thing's that we look up to you for. To help us help ourselves, help us find solutions, not temporary fixes to the problem.....I urge, our leaders, and community official's to dig deeper, and come up with workable solutions. Not band-aids.
